The book is posted in the files section of the Elmers Engines Yahoogroups in one-engine-per-PDF form. I think there are 4 of the groups to fit all the files, so sign up for all 4 and you'll have access in a day or two. I recombined them in Acrobat one day just for convenience, but it's a 70 MB file then.

http://groups.yahoo.com/search?query=elmers+engines

There's also a web site with them posted, but I don't have that URL handy. The Yahoogroup contains the copyright owner who gave permission to distribute the PDFs, and has people who can give advice on the engines, so I prefer that route anyway.
